Output 90d525798922f7c86ab9f66ab07fdd882dfca097ef0d03e6d43ef4144601f5fa:0

value
368685788
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3e8ada4ceb64b35d3805370f1c1f199582c9dad0 OP_EQUAL
address
37PiA6S6x3pCfRrgDtn7nyNZvPgQ9dQgZ6
transaction
90d525798922f7c86ab9f66ab07fdd882dfca097ef0d03e6d43ef4144601f5fa